Transaction 104bb41b72f73a02fdb50d064ddf4bb93687ab750f0531c6adc7d2ff4b4ecd04

2 Input
2 Outputs
  • 104bb41b72f73a02fdb50d064ddf4bb93687ab750f0531c6adc7d2ff4b4ecd04:0
  • value  665000000
    address  3FNZoRH1L1KFVaDHARyxws18GvqxNG5a3Z
  • 104bb41b72f73a02fdb50d064ddf4bb93687ab750f0531c6adc7d2ff4b4ecd04:1
  • value  334612992
    address  37biYvTEcBVMoR1NGkPTGvHUuLTrzcLpiv